Forgetting your password means you will be completely locked out of your device if you reboot.How to Change Your Android Encryption Password Without Changing Your Lock Screen Password.PIN lock and other updates to Outlook for iOS and Android. Encryption is enabled by default.Encrypt Your Samsung Galaxy S 4. after you encrypt your phone,. the password must include at least six characters with at least one number.

Managing Galaxy S6 Security and the Lock Screen. Change Encryption, Password,.We use our android phones for storing. without being interrupted by password.As for the JCE, etc. implementation on Android, yes it does use Bouncy Castle, but that is an implementation detail you cannot rely on.There are, of course, a few differences, the major one being that while AppsOnSD (just like app Android 4.1 app encryption ) creates per-app encrypted containers, adoptable storage encrypts the whole device.Encrypt your Android smartphone for paranoid-level. an encrypted Android.Certain vendors such as LG or custom ROMs such as CM13 have slightly modified the syntax required to use cryptfs, so you will need to adjust and use the correct syntax.

PBKDF1 applies a hash function (MD5 or SHA-1) multiple times to the salt and password, feeding the output of each round to next one to produce the final output.I am trying to change the password I use when starting the phone.Disclaimer: if you choose to use the method described below to change your encryption password, you are doing so at your own risk.The password will be input by the user, and the iteration count is generally fixed (if you decide to make it variable, you need to store it along with the other parameters), so that leaves the salt and the IV.

Next we generate a random IV, initialize the cipher and output the cipher text.

You are very unlikely to use the whole of SC, so most of it will be removed.Consider using Base64 encoding to covert to string, if you need to.Changes the Android disk encryption password New: Experimental Lollipop support.

When iOS debuted in 2014, Google quickly announced that it would make full disk encryption mandatory under Android 5.0, codenamed Lollipop — and then backed off.The default Android system does allow you to encrypt your whole device, but if you are looking to encrypt selected files, you will need a third-party app.Android incorporates industry-leading security features and works with developers and device implementers to keep the Android platform and ecosystem safe.

To sum this up: a symmetric encryption key needs to be random to provide sufficient security, and user-entered passwords are a poor source of randomness.If a device implementation is already launched on an earlier Android version with full-disk encryption disabled by default, such a device cannot meet the requirement.For other options regarding protecting keys, see this article.

Additionally, on Jelly Bean (4.1) Android can take advantage of hardware to protect keys.

A KeyGenerator is then initialized with the SecureRandom instance, making sure that our password-seeded PRNG will be used when generating keys.Note that those may differ even between different Android platform or Java SE versions.To be able to decrypt the cipher text we need: the password, the iteration count, the salt and the IV.

If you are on a version of Android prior to 5.0 Lollipop, then enter the following command.

I only mention it here because it seems to be especially widespread on Android.Xettings Lets You Customize the Status Bar and Quick Settings in AOSPA.Understanding Disk Encryption on Android and iOS. After ensuring that the device has a PIN or password,.How cheap: essentially the cost of a SHA-1 hash round, which is generally implemented in native code and is pretty fast.All Android devices are different, but they all come with some basic security and privacy features.Hi Nikolay, I have tested your android PBE on a Nexus 5 running Lollipop.

Long-time Android enthusiast starting from all the way back to the Sprint HTC Hero.That will show a confirmation dialog on the phone prompting you to authorize the backup and optionally specify a backup encryption password.

